Autodesk 3ds Max 2019 is expected to be released on March 22, 2018. Some of the new features and enhancements have been previewed. Among them we find:
Advanced Wood Map:
Advanced Wood is a new procedure map.
Highly customizable way to generate wood textures.
Includes presets for maple, cherry and oak.
Designed to work closely with the physical material, with outputs that can be used directly on the material, such as Roughness and Stroke.
OSL Map and Open Shading Language:
It contains a variety of preset maps, the OSL map or the development of your own OSL map.
Allows you to write your own shaders.
Allows to download and use existing OSL shaders.
To be able to see dynamic updates both in the user interface and in the resulting map in ActiveShade.
Shape Booleans:
Shape booleans allow you to combine splines into new shapes using boolean operations.
User interface similar to booleans 3D.
Dynamic chamfer / fillets for created vertices.
It works in both closed and open forms.
Useful for creating floor plans, motion graphics and any object/workflow that uses splines as a starting primitive.
Shared views:
Shared Views allow you to share your models with someone online and receive their feedback.
Publish a complete model or a selection directly from 3ds Max.
View and share designs in the browser.
Collaborators use a URL, they do not need to install software.
Print views that are important
Screenshots for use in e-mails and presentations.
Access collaboration comments directly in 3ds Max or through your web browser.
3DS Max Interactive:
Virtual reality editing is now possible with the new Level Viewport VR, which allows you to use VR headsets to enter and edit levels in virtual reality.
The intelligent placement tool provides an intuitive way to accurately place objects when working in the level window or editing the scene in virtual reality.
Live Transform Tracking mode synchronizes the transformation controls between 3ds Max and 3ds Max Interactive.
3ds Max photometric lights are now imported as physical lights into 3ds Max Interactive. All associated IES files are also imported.
The new flexible VR Desktop template can be used with Oculus or HTC Vive systems.
